INGREDIENTS
- 1 small cinnamon stick
- 1/4 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 250 millilitres of hot water

PREPARATION
These steps are followed for the preparation of Cinnamon Vanilla Herbal Tea:
- Boil The Water: Bring 250 millilitres of water to a boil using a kettle or stovetop pot.
- Add The Cinnamon: Place the cinnamon stick (or ground cinnamon) into a :heatproof cup or mug.
- Pour Hot Water: Carefully pour the hot water over the cinnamon in the mug.
- Steep The Tea: Let the cinnamon infuse in the hot water for 5 to 7 minutes to release its flavour and aroma.
- Add Vanilla: Stir in the vanilla extract after steeping.
- Optional Sweetener: If desired, add 1/2 teaspoon of honey or sweetener of choice and stir gently.

TIPS
- Use A Lid While Steeping: Cover your mug with a small plate while the cinnamon steeps to retain heat and deepen the infusion.
- Strain If Needed: If using ground cinnamon, stir thoroughly and allow sediment to settle before drinking. Alternatively, use a tea strainer.
- Double For Later: This recipe can be easily doubled and stored for chilled use later in the day.
VARIATIONS
- Creamier Version: Replace half the water with unsweetened almond or oat milk for a richer texture and flavour.
- Add Ginger: Include a small slice of fresh ginger for added warmth and digestive benefits.
- Citrus Twist: Add a dash of fresh lemon juice or a strip of lemon peel for a refreshing citrus note.
- Chilled Tea: Chill in the fridge and serve over ice with a cinnamon stick stirrer for a refreshing summer drink.
- Spiced Blend: Add a pinch of nutmeg or clove for a deeper and spiced experience similar to chai.
PREPPING AND STORAGE
- Short-Term Storage: Store leftover tea in the fridge in a sealed glass jar for up to 2 days. Reheat gently before serving or enjoy cold.
- Freezing: Pour into an ice cube tray and freeze. Use the cubes later in smoothies or other teas for a subtle cinnamon-vanilla flavour.
- Make Ahead: Prepare in bulk and store in the fridge. Add vanilla extract just before serving to preserve its aromatic intensity.
- Re-Steep Option: Cinnamon sticks can be reused once or twice for additional cups, though with a slightly milder flavour.
